Exemple #1
0
 private void AugmentPageTemplateViewModel(IPageTemplateViewModelCreatedEvent ev)
 {
     if (ev != null && ev.PageTemplate != null && ev.ViewModel != null && ev.ViewModel.Framework == PageTemplateFramework.Mvc && !string.IsNullOrEmpty(ev.ViewModel.Name))
     {
         var package = (new PackageManager()).GetPackageFromTemplate(ev.PageTemplate);
         if (!string.IsNullOrEmpty(package))
         {
             ev.ViewModel.PackageBasedOn = package;
         }
     }
 }
Exemple #2
0
 private void AugmentPageTemplateViewModel(IPageTemplateViewModelCreatedEvent ev)
 {
     if (ev != null && ev.PageTemplate != null && ev.ViewModel != null && ev.ViewModel.Framework == PageTemplateFramework.Mvc && !string.IsNullOrEmpty(ev.ViewModel.Name))
     {
         var package = (new PackageManager()).GetPackageFromTemplate(ev.PageTemplate);
         if (!string.IsNullOrEmpty(package))
         {
             ev.ViewModel.PackageBasedOn = package;
         }
     }
 }